The Curse

Details

  • Title: 凄絶!嫁姑戦争 羅刹の家
  • Title (romaji): Seizetsu! Yome Shuuto Senso Rasetsu no Ie
  • Also known as: The Curse
  • Genre: Family drama
  • Episodes: 12
  • Broadcast network: TV Asahi
  • Broadcast period: 1998-Apr-09 to 1998-Jun-25
  • Theme song: Tamaiki, by Sha Ran Q (シャ乱Q)

Synopsis

The enmity between a young wife and her mother-in-law is a popular subject for writers in Japan. If you thought Satsuki (Making It Through) had it bad, you'll be shocked to see the lengths to which Ayano goes to torment her daughter-in-law, Yoko. This dramatization of a popular comic book serial had viewers in Japan glued to their TV sets. Kato Noriko stars as the innocent young wife, and veteran actress Yamamoto Yoko stars as the mother-in-law from Hell. --KikuTV
